KVM has a union of 64bit sys_regs[] and 32bit copro[]. The 32bit accessors read the high or low part of the 64bit sys_reg[] value through the union. Both sys_reg_descs[] and cp15_regs[] list access_csselr() as the accessor for CSSELR{,_EL1}. access_csselr() is only aware of the 64bit sys_regs[], and expects r->reg to be 'CSSELR_EL1' in the enum, index 2 of the 64bit array. cp15_regs[] uses the 32bit copro[] alias of sys_regs[]. Here CSSELR is c0_CSSELR which is the same location in sys_reg[]. r->reg is 'c0_CSSELR', index 4 in the 32bit array. access_csselr() uses the 32bit r->reg value to access the 64bit array, so reads and write the wrong value. sys_regs[4], is ACTLR_EL1, which is subsequently save/restored when we enter the guest. ACTLR_EL1 is supposed to be read-only for the guest. This register only affects execution at EL1, and the host's value is restored before we return to host EL1. Rename access_csselr() to access_csselr_el1(), to indicate it expects the 64bit register index, and pass it CSSELR_EL1 from cp15_regs[].
